Bionic Commando - Elite Forces (USA)
Inside Bionic Commando - Elite Forces (USA)
Bionic Commando: Elite Forces is a Game Boy Color action platformer that arrived in the US around the year 2000. It's part of the Bionic Commando series, known for its signature grappling hook mechanic. While the original games were published by Capcom, the exact developer of this portable entry is not widely documented, but it stands as a solid, standalone title for the handheld.
How to Play Bionic Commando - Elite Forces (USA) Online
You take control of a bionic soldier tasked with stopping the evil Arturus. Your main tool is the bionic arm that lets you swing across gaps and climb vertical surfaces. The core loop involves moving through side-scrolling levels, shooting enemies with your gun, and using the grapple to reach higher platforms or avoid hazards. Each stage ends when you reach the exit or defeat a boss.
New players should focus on mastering the swinging motion - aim the arm at overhead rails or ceilings. The game uses a password system to save progress, so be sure to write down the code you receive after completing a level. Take your time exploring; some areas hide useful items or alternate routes.
